Quarterly Planning Note — Divestiture of the Coastal Tooling Unit

For the finance team: the sale of the Coastal Tooling unit to Pellmark Industries remains on track for close in Q3. Please finalize the carve-out balance sheet, reconcile intercompany positions, and prepare the working-capital adjustment schedule by month-end. Audit support requests should be prioritized. For planning purposes, note the following sensitive item:

internal memo for hawef-kahif: The finance team signed off on a budget of $25.9 million for Project Sorox. The renewal with Pelokek Logistics closes at $51.7 million a year, 52 percent below the last contract.

The garage occupancy feed for the Brindlewood campus arrives over a message queue every thirty seconds, one record per level, published by the Stallgrid edge boxes. Counts can briefly go negative when a sensor double-fires on exit; the ingest job clamps these to zero and flags the interval. If the feed stalls for more than five minutes, the dashboard falls back to the last known snapshot. Sensor mappings, queue names, and the replay procedure are documented on the internal page below.

runbook for tahog-kadug: https://gitlab.qirvanworks.corp/projects/pages/view/b139298aed28

### Webhook Retry Semantics

Support note: Tidemark retries failed webhook deliveries on an exponential schedule — 30s, 2m, 10m, then hourly up to 24 attempts. A 2xx response halts retries; 410 permanently disables the endpoint. Customers asking about duplicates should check idempotency headers first. To replay a delivery manually through the internal replay service, authenticate with the key below.

gateway credential: kto3_qfe